Climb information
The Alto Rey from Puente de piedra, located in the Guadalajara region, is one of the most demanding climbs in the world. With a total length of 16.36 kilometers and an average gradient of 5.79%, this climb challenges even the most experienced cyclists.
Why Ride the Alto Rey from Puente de piedra?
The Alto Rey from Puente de piedra is a true test of strength and endurance. Known for its steep gradients and long ascent, this climb has earned its HC category rating, pushing cyclists to their absolute limits. Rising from 937 meters to 1843 meters, it provides an epic climb of 946 meters over 16.36 kilometers.
